Serves as subject matter expert on retrofit control systems and electrical engineering principles and provides expert knowledge and guidance to colleagues as needed.
Provides control systems design technical leadership in a matrixed environment, ensuring on-time schedule, performance, project milestones, customer deliverables, and compliance with regulations and standards.
Applies electrical engineering principles to analyze, propose, design, program, test and troubleshoot control systems associated within complex material handling systems.
Reviews contract documentation and customer specifications and creates equipment specifications and detailed design documentation for the development of appropriate control solutions.
Supports realization team on project installation, commissioning and testing of control systems, traveling frequently as required.
Develops technical documentation including control system specifications and engineering procedures and assists with creation of user manuals.
Bachelor’s Deg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or equivalent technical degree, or equivalent work experience.
Minimum of four (4) years of controls engineering experience, preferably in a material-handling, industrial, or manufacturing environment. (Retrofit experience preferred.)
Advanced knowledge of PLC ladder logic and programming and proficiency in Siemens, Rockwell and Allen Bradley PLCs.
Thorough understanding of fieldbus systems and I/O equipment, e.g., Profibus, Profinet, ASi, TCP/IP.
